Report: Maple Leafs currently focused on one hire, open minded to different types of FO structures
""It's still very wide open. There's a lot of fixation I'd say here in the Toronto market on one job, one structure, this or that. Keith Pelley is not committed to what the structure of that front office is gonna be.""
""The Leafs are really rebuilding a front office. It starts with hiring one person who's gonna sit at the top of the hockey operation structure. But they're re-imagining how they work, how things go within that front office to make sure they're correctly making use of all the resources available.""
The Toronto Maple Leafs are prioritizing the hiring of a head of hockey operations, with flexibility regarding the front-office structure. Keith Pelley is not committed to a specific structure, allowing the new hire to shape it. There is no clear favorite for the position, and promoting an assistant GM is unlikely. The team aims to interview multiple candidates, emphasizing the need for a data-centric approach in managing hockey operations. The focus is on rebuilding the front office and optimizing resource utilization.
